diff --git a/deluge/ui/webui/templates/ajax/static/js/deluge-add.js b/deluge/ui/webui/templates/ajax/static/js/deluge-add.js index 7b190210b..889514b44 100644 --- a/deluge/ui/webui/templates/ajax/static/js/deluge-add.js +++ b/deluge/ui/webui/templates/ajax/static/js/deluge-add.js @@ -359,6 +359,11 @@ Deluge.Widgets.AddTorrent.OptionsTab = new Class({ }, onGetConfigSuccess: function(config) { + this.default_config = config; + this.setFormToDefault(); + }, + + setFormToDefault: function() { this.form.add_paused.checked = config['add_paused']; $each(this.form.compact_allocation, function(el) { if (el.value == config['compact_allocation'].toString()) { @@ -372,6 +377,10 @@ Deluge.Widgets.AddTorrent.OptionsTab = new Class({ $$W(this.form.max_upload_speed_per_torrent).setValue(config['max_upload_speed_per_torrent']); $$W(this.form.max_connections_per_torrent).setValue(config['max_connections_per_torrent']); $$W(this.form.max_upload_slots_per_torrent).setValue(config['max_upload_slots_per_torrent']); + }, + + setTorrent: function(torrent) { + } }); diff --git a/deluge/ui/webui/templates/ajax/static/themes/white/mime_icons/image.png b/deluge/ui/webui/templates/ajax/static/themes/white/mime_icons/image.png new file mode 100644 index 000000000..ff783f5c0 Binary files /dev/null and b/deluge/ui/webui/templates/ajax/static/themes/white/mime_icons/image.png differ diff --git a/deluge/ui/webui/templates/ajax/static/themes/white/mime_icons/unknown.png b/deluge/ui/webui/templates/ajax/static/themes/white/mime_icons/unknown.png new file mode 100644 index 000000000..bcdf6973f Binary files /dev/null and b/deluge/ui/webui/templates/ajax/static/themes/white/mime_icons/unknown.png differ